codeceptjs-api-test

codeceptjs-api-test

Projeto de automação de testes web utilizando CodeceptJS, Cucumber e Allure Report, executando via GitHub Actions e publicando o relatório da execução no GitHub Pages.

Dependências

  • CodeceptJS: 3.5.12
  • Allure CodeceptJS: 2.12.0

Instalação

Instale codeceptjs-api-test com npm

  cd codeceptjs-api-test
  npm install

Rodando os testes

Para rodar os testes, rode o seguinte comando

  npx codeceptjs run --plugins allure

Relatório dos testes

Gerar o Allure Report

  allure serve allure-results

Apagar o Allure Report de execuções anteriores

  allure generate --clean --output allure-results

Visualizar o Allure Report publicado Visualizar

Demonstração

Assistir vídeo da execução

Screenshots